共计 985 个字符,预计需要花费 3 分钟才能阅读完成。
网站崩溃是互联网用户常常遇到的问题,它不仅影响用户体验,还可能导致企业损失。了解崩溃的常见原因,有助于我们及时应对和修复问题。以下是一些普遍的原因:
当网站的访问量突然增加时,尤其是在促销活动或资讯发布期间,服务器可能会承受不住而崩溃。此时,网站流量超出了其承载能力,导致无法响应用户请求。
硬件损坏或软件错误都可能导致服务器崩溃。如果服务器没有及时维护和更新,可能会出现过载、内存不足或散热不良等问题。
网站的代码或数据库存在缺陷,也会造成崩溃。例如,未正确处理的异常、内存泄漏或无限循环,这些都可能导致脚本运行缓慢或直接中断。
如何检测并恢复崩溃的网站
检测网站崩溃的迹象通常可以通过快速测试和监控工具实现。管理员可以使用以下方法来判断问题所在:
借助专业的监控工具可以实时检查网站的可用性和性能。这些工具能够提供流量分析、错误日志和服务器负载等数据,帮助快速定位崩溃原因。
尝试直接访问网站,查看是否能成功加载。如果无法加载,则检查服务器是否在运行,访问日志以寻找错误信息。
修复网站崩溃的方法
一旦确认网站崩溃,采取相应措施进行修复是至关重要的。
若是由于流量激增导致崩溃,可以考虑升级服务器,增加内存或带宽,以应对未来的流量高峰。
对网站进行优化,比如压缩图片、使用 CDN 加速、缓存机制等,能够有效减少服务器负担,改善加载速度。
定期对代码进行审查和调试,修复已知的缺陷,确保程序的稳定运行。及时更新和维护软件,也在一定程度上减少了崩溃的风险。
提前预防崩溃的措施
为避免网站崩溃带来的负面影响,可以采取以下预防措施:
通过负载均衡技术,将用户请求分散到多个服务器上运行,增强处理能力,减轻单个服务器压力。
定期进行压力测试,模拟高流量情况,以评估网站在极端条件下的表现。同时,演练应急预案,确保在崩溃发生时能迅速恢复服务。
制定并实施网站备份计划,确保数据的安全。一旦发生崩溃,能迅速恢复到最近的稳定版本,减少损失。
结语
及时识别和修复网站崩溃问题,对维护良好的用户体验和保护企业利益至关重要。通过深入了解崩溃的原因及采取有效的预防措施,能够在很大程度上避免不必要的损失和麻烦。面对不断增长的互联网流量和复杂的技术环境,保持警觉并及时应对是每个网站管理员的重要责任。